Job description

As we prepare to deliver a significant capital programme over the next five years, we're investing in the growth and development of our design department.

We're seeking a Principal Mechanical Engineer with water industry experience to help shape the future of our water infrastructure department by bringing strong technical expertise, innovative thinking and leadership to our team.

What you'll do

This is a unique opportunity to influence major projects from concept to construction, delivering innovative, sustainable, and best-value solutions that are safe to build, operate, and maintain.

Your typical day-to-day in this role can include:

  • contributing to the overall strategic technical direction and standards for our Mechanical Engineering team
  • leading mechanical design across the full spectrum of water and wastewater infrastructure, including abstraction, boreholes, treatment works and sewage networks
  • developing and evaluating options to identify the least whole-life cost solutions
  • reviewing and approving mechanical schedules, drawings and P&IDs
  • reviewing and approving technical reports, calculations, designs and drawings for compliance with our health and safety, technical, legal and environmental standards
  • providing expert technical guidance and mentoring to support Mechanical Engineers in developing appropriate and cost-effective solutions
  • collaborating with other engineering disciplines to ensure scope alignment and integrated delivery
  • mentoring junior Engineers and actively contributing to team development
  • preparing design fee proposals and scheme design programmes
  • liaising with Site Managers on technical issues
  • ensuring design proceeds in line with budgetary and programme constraints, and that the project management team are aware of the state of progress.
What you'll need

You'll need to be a proactive, solutions-focused engineer with a passion for excellence and innovation.

You'll bring:

  • deep industry knowledge as a seasoned professional within the water sector, with a proven track record of success in senior-level roles
  • further, seasoned experience ideally within the water industry, but other relevant industries can be considered
  • a Chartered Engineering qualification with a relevant institution
  • a degree in Mechanical Engineering or a related discipline
  • experience working with contractors, clients and stakeholders
  • strong understanding of risk management, particularly environmental risks
  • excellent communication, negotiation and influencing skills
  • a positive, adaptable mindset and a strong team ethic.

Who we are

YTL UK is part of the international YTL Group based in Kuala Lumpur. The UK companies include:

  • Wessex Water – one of the top-performing water and sewerage companies in England and Wales, serving 2.9 million people across the South West
  • YTL Developments – a major UK developer currently redeveloping a 350 acre former airfield into an award winning, exciting mix of houses, apartments, schools, commercial space, restaurants and hotels, to make a truly sustainable new community
  • YTL Construction UK – a top 20 UK contractor providing fully integrated services to infrastructure, residential, commercial, industry, energy and environmental sectors
  • YTL Arena – the development and operation of an entertainment complex that includes a 20,000 capacity arena, conferencing and exhibition space
  • plus a number of other retail, environmental and specialist businesses.
